Hastelloy Tube: Rising Prices and What Buyers Must Know

Hastelloy Tube: Rising Prices and What Buyers Must Know

Hastelloy tube is a mission-critical component in some of the world’s most demanding industrial environments. From the heat exchangers of Gulf desalination plants to the reactor vessels of chemical processing facilities, Hastelloy tubes provide a level of corrosion resistance that no standard stainless steel grade can match. Yet in 2026, procurement teams across the UAE and broader Middle East are navigating tighter supply, longer lead times, and more unpredictable market conditions than at any point in recent history.

Understanding Hastelloy Tube: Grades and Applications

Hastelloy tube is manufactured in multiple grades, most notably C-276, C-22, B-2, B-3, and X. Each grade is engineered for specific chemical exposure profiles. C-276 tubing — the most widely procured grade in the Middle East — offers superior performance in hydrochloric acid, sulfuric acid, and chloride-containing environments prevalent in desalination plants and oil refinery heat exchangers. Hastelloy X tubes are used in high-temperature applications such as gas turbine and aerospace components.

Hastelloy tubes are produced to ASTM B622 for seamless construction and ASTM B619 for welded configurations. In GCC project specifications, compliance with NACE MR0175/ISO 15156 for sour service environments is frequently mandated.

The Global Nickel Supply Situation

The price trajectory of Hastelloy tube is directly tied to global nickel supply dynamics. Nickel represents the dominant cost component of the alloy, and its availability has been constrained since the disruption of Russian supply through sanctions introduced after the 2022 invasion of Ukraine. While Indonesian nickel production has partially filled the gap, converting laterite-sourced nickel intermediates into the high-purity alloy-grade refined metal required for superalloy manufacturing remains a bottleneck that continues to affect the market in 2026.

The explosive growth of the electric vehicle industry has simultaneously created sustained demand-side competition for alloy-grade nickel, keeping supply tight regardless of broader economic cycles.

How Conflict Zones Are Reshaping Trade Flows

Middle East Regional Tensions

Ongoing instability in the broader Middle East — including maritime security threats in the Red Sea — has elevated shipping insurance premiums and extended transit times for Hastelloy tube imported to UAE ports from European or North American mills. The added cost of Cape of Good Hope rerouting is now embedded in the landed price of imported alloy tube.

Ukraine’s Industrial Capacity

Ukraine was a meaningful producer of ferroalloys and processed metals prior to the 2022 invasion. The destruction of industrial capacity in the country’s eastern regions removed a secondary supply source for certain alloy inputs, placing additional demand burden on remaining global production capacity.

Demand Growth in GCC Infrastructure

The UAE and Saudi Arabia’s ongoing port expansion programs, offshore energy developments, and industrial diversification projects have generated strong domestic demand for Hastelloy tube products, adding a regional pressure that competes directly with available global supply.

Seamless Hastelloy tube (ASTM B622) is manufactured without a weld seam, producing a homogeneous microstructure with consistent mechanical properties throughout the tube wall — preferred for high-pressure and highly corrosive service. Welded Hastelloy tube (ASTM B619/B626) is more cost-effective and suitable for lower-pressure applications where budget constraints apply.
